On average across the year,
yes, Tunisia is hotter than
Nunavut, Canada
.
Tunisia has an average temperature of 20°C/68°F and Nunavut, Canada has an average temperature of -8°C/18°F.
Tunisia's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 36°C/97°F, which is hotter than Nunavut, Canada's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 12°C/54°F).
On average across the year, no, Tunisia is not colder than Nunavut, Canada . Tunisia has an average minimum temperature of 14°C/57°F and Nunavut, Canada has an average minimum temperature of -12°C/10°F.
On average across the year,
no, Tunisia has less rain than
Nunavut, Canada. Tunisia has an average annual rainfall of 290mm and Nunavut, Canada has an average annual rainfall of 330mm.
Tunisia's wettest month is October, with an average monthly rainfall of 41mm, which is drier than Nunavut, Canada's wettest month (July, with an average monthly rainfall of 60mm).
